Boynton Beach, FL (February 15, 2026) – A rollover crash on Florida’s Turnpike in Boynton Beach left one person dead and sent six others to the hospital Saturday, February 14. Palm Beach County Fire Rescue responded to reports of a rollover along the northbound lanes near Mile Marker 90. Upon arrival, crews located an SUV and a truck with severe damage and found multiple patients at the scene.

Officials confirmed that a total of seven people were involved in the crash. Six individuals were transported to area hospitals as trauma alerts, while one person was pronounced deceased at the scene. Firefighters and paramedics worked to provide emergency medical care and secure the area as traffic along the Turnpike was affected during the response. The Florida Highway Patrol has taken over the investigation into the cause of the crash.
